"Batik Pizazz", The Clare Peterson Memorial Scholarship Fund Donation Quilt Project volunteers are Sandy Towey, Glenna McKandles, Norma Herman, Gloria Villalobos, and Judith White |
|
The members of the Clare Peterson Memorial Scholarship project, have made and are raffling off a beautiful quilt, "Batik Pizazz". The money raised by the raffle will provide scholarships to deserving graduating high school seniors. The project's goal is to be able to award scholarships of $1,500 each to three deserving young people. The drawing for the quilt will be held 21 Nov 2009 at our monthly guild meeting. Tickets are $5 each, and only 300 tickets were printed, so, your chance for winning is pretty good!
